Evelyn Rubenstein Jewish Community Center of Houston
About the Project
After the toll Hurricane Harvey took on the Jewish Community Center in Houston, TX, Butler-Cohen was hired to furnish and install (2) automatic flood gates at the main entrances, one gate being 27’ and the smaller one measuring 5’. This process included installing new concrete wall sections, pouring foundation for gates, placing and leveling the system, paving demolition and new curb approach, and excavation for drain at each gate location. We protected existing flood lights below by removing them during the construction and reinstalling at completion. Modifications to the existing detention pond we made to meet City of Houston flood mitigation requirements. Finally the gates were put to the test which included building a temporary barrier and simulating a flood to demonstrate the passive automatic operation of the gate.
